These days many people prefer to work longer hours and spend less time at home. Are there more advantages than disadvantages to this trend?

Submitted Essay
In today's fast-paced world, a growing number of people are choosing to sacrifice their time at home for longer work hours. While this may bring certain benefits, it also affects individual well-being and the delicate balance between work and personal life.

Firstly, transparency and engagement have become imperative in workplaces, given the pressing need for professional growth and financial stability. To explain, in an increasingly competitive job market, dedication and a solid work ethic have emerged as crucial factors for achieving success. When employees engage in overtime, it showcases their dedication and can lead to advancement and raises. Moreover, companies in rapidly-evolving industries like technology and finance thrive on productivity and staying ahead of their counterparts. In this context, employees who are willing to invest more time may stand out and contribute to the success of their organizations.

Conversely, while this trend has its merits, it's important not to overlook the drawbacks. The demanding work culture can result in burnout, heightened stress levels, and a decline in both mental and physical well-being. It is significant to recognize the importance of maintaining a healthy work-life balance as excessive work hours can harm productivity and job satisfaction.

To conclude, although working longer hours may bring benefits in terms of advancement and monetary rewards, it is imperative to acknowledge the potential drawbacks on individuals' overall well-being and work-life harmony. It is crucial for both employers and employees to prioritize creating work cultures that foster productivity while valuing the significance of maintaining a healthy equilibrium between work and personal life.
